Tidebringer is a silver weapon with its hilt encrusted by coral and barnacles; it gives a +2 bonus to attack and damage rolls when used. The blade drips with foamy seawater when charged. When the blade is wet, the wielder can fling a blade of razor-sharp water as a ranged attack to 60 ft, doing the same damage as when used in melee. The scimitar must soak for 1 round in water before being used this way again. Tidebringer can be used underwater with no penalty.
Proficiency with a Scimitar allows you to add your proficiency bonus to the attack roll for any attack you make with it.
This weapon has the following mastery property. To use this property, you must have a feature that lets you use it.
Nick. When you make the extra attack of the Light property, you can make it as part of the Attack action instead of as a Bonus Action. You can make this extra attack only once per turn.
